Score-based generative diffusion with "active" correlated noise sources

Alexandra Lamtyugina, Agnish Kumar Behera, Aditya Nandy et al.

Diffusion models exhibit robust generative properties by approximating the underlying distribution of a dataset and synthesizing data by sampling from the approximated distribution. In this work, we explore how the generative performance may be be modulated if noise sources with temporal correlations -- akin to those used in the field of active matter -- are used for the destruction of the data in the forward process. Our numerical and analytical experiments suggest that the corresponding reverse process may exhibit improved generative properties.
